Vinoteca London Description

Opened in September 2005, Vinoteca has built a reputation as one of London’s most exciting Wine Bars and Shops, renowned for offering an exceptional range of wines from around the world at great value prices. The award-winning Wine Bar serves over 25 wines by the glass, changing every week, and over 275 wines by the bottle. The seasonal menu changes daily and provides the best of British & European cooking. All of the wines are available to take home from their Wine Shop, listed at competitive retail prices, and delivery both inside and outside of London is available.

Vinoteca's comfortable interior with its oak furniture and wine filled shelves creates a genuinely friendly, relaxed and bustling atmosphere. Customers are able to choose from a list of around 25 different wines by the glass which changes on a weekly basis, and covers a wide range of styles. Prices start at £2.95 for a 175ml glass and all the food is matched to one of their wines by the glass.

Vinoteca is passionate about serving high quality, fresh food in a comfortable, informal environment. All the food is prepared in the open plan kitchen and the menu changes daily in order to make the most of seasonal produce. Inspired equally by British and European cooking, dishes are created which perfectly complement their diverse range of wine styles. Bread is baked freshly on the premises twice a day. The chefs buy meat directly from local Smithfield Market, source high quality sustainable fresh fish and seafood from first-class suppliers and use only seasonal fruit and vegetables. They also import a range of cured meats from Jabugo in southwest Spain, including the delicious and unique ham from acorn-fed Pata Negra. .

Food is served from 12pm to 2.45 pm and 6.30 to 10.00pm. Bookings are taken for lunchtimes only.

Vinoteca has also recently opened a Private Dining Room, featuring its own open kitchen and wine cellar. The room, with its comfortable, stylish and relaxed feel is ideal for all kinds of events and wine tastings.
